Trying to turn a WRX into a FrankenSTi is going to cost you a lot more than the difference in cost between a new WRX and a new STi, unless you get the salvage vehicle really cheap and do the work yourself. But, if you have a huge amount of time on your hands and a well-equiped shop in your garage, you might have a lot of fun doing it and not mind all of the extra $$$ you'll have to spend.
gas mileage
as far as time and money for the swap, I agree ^. Waaay more expensive to do the swap than just buying an STI, not to mention it'd be a new car with a warranty, rather than FrankenSTI. Paint, however, is also incredibly expensive. A good paint job is a couple thousand dollars, and a cheap paint job is a HORRIBLE idea because it will look terrible in 6 months.
As far as gas mileage, a modded 300 HP WRX will get about the same mileage as an STI, which is an average in the high teens when driven sanely, low 20's if driven saintly.

if you are seriously concerned about gas mileage- stay away from anything STi related- not sure of what type of driving you do... but i average about 16-17mpg(mild mods) with a very aggressive driving pattern. there is no SUCH thing as driving a STi conservatively- you will get on the throttle at least once or twice-daily.
my wife gets about 22-24mpg in her wrx- which really isn't that great, but very respectable(considering)- if you are lusting after the STi - go for it. don't fool around with a swap uunless you are the type that enjoy's the pride and joy(and sweat,tears and blood) involved in a project like this.
keep in mind that bug eyes are very soft on the market. even with a limited production like yours...in order for it to have max value it basically has to be garaged..(there is one in the dupont registry for 20g's)
